'Ardeshīr', 'Ardashīr', or 'Ardashēr' is Middle Persian for "whose reign is through
''arda'' (truth)" and may refer to:
★ the throne name of several emperors:
★
★
Ardeshir I Papakan, ''r.'' 224 - 241, founder of the
2nd Persian Empire.
★
★
Ardeshir II Bahram, ''r.'' 379 - 383, son of
Hormizd II and successor of
Shapur II "the Great"
★
★
Ardeshir III Kavadh, ''r.'' 628 - 630, the youngest of the
Sassanid kings.
★
★ ''Ardeshir'' is also the Middle Persian equivalent of
Old Persian ''Artaxšacā'' (Latinized
Artaxerxes), the throne name of five emperors of the
1st Persian Empire.
